Professional Dehumidification in Portland, OR

High humidity keeps materials wet even after water is extracted. Industrial dehumidifiers pull moisture from the air so walls, floors, and framing can dry correctly. We size and place equipment for your space and track humidity until levels are safe.

Why Dehumidification Matters

Without humidity control, drying stalls and mold risk climbs:

Stops re-wetting of materials

Speeds structural dry-out

Reduces mold conditions

Protects indoor air quality

Our Process

How Dehumidification Fits the Dry-Out

Dehumidifiers work with air movers as a complete drying system — not a standalone fix.

1

Measure Humidity

We record indoor humidity and temperature to size the right equipment.

2

Deploy Units

Commercial dehumidifiers are placed for airflow and grain depression targets.

3

Balance Airflow

Air movers and dehumidifiers are adjusted together for efficient drying.

4

Confirm Dry Air

We keep equipment running until humidity and material readings stay in range.

Time Matters

Why Act Fast

Standing water and high humidity can lead to mold growth in as little as 24 to 48 hours, plus warping, swelling, and structural weakening. Calling quickly protects your property and typically lowers the total cost of repairs.
